I love a good ghost story, this one is something of a period piece, starting in the present and going to a previous haunting in the same house back in the 1800's that parallels what is currently happening. Donald Sutherland and Sissy Spacek do a great job in this movie. It was an okay flick, the story was good, but it felt almost like a made-for-TV flick.
